Exemplo n.º 1
0
 public CssVisitorEditNameSelector(IFactoryNames factoryNames, ITokenFactory factoryTokens)
 {
     this.factoryNames  = factoryNames;
     this.factoryTokens = factoryTokens;
     editId             = new CssEditNameIdSelector(factoryTokens, factoryNames);
     editClass          = new CssEditNameClassSelector(factoryTokens, factoryNames);
 }
Exemplo n.º 2
0
        public FactoryEditor(IFactoryNames factoryNames)
        {
            this.factoryNames = factoryNames;

            editors = new Dictionary <TypeEditor, ITextEditor>();

            editors.Add(
                TypeEditor.Css,
                new CssEditor(factoryNames)
                );
            editors.Add(
                TypeEditor.Html,
                new HtmlEditor(factoryNames, this)
                );
            editors.Add(
                TypeEditor.Js,
                new JsEditor(factoryNames)
                );
        }
Exemplo n.º 3
0
 public ChangeTokenAtributeValue(ITokenFactory factoryTokens, IFactoryNames factoryNames, bool isCreateNew = true)
 {
     this.factoryTokens = factoryTokens;
     this.factoryNames  = factoryNames;
     this.isCreateNew   = isCreateNew;
 }
Exemplo n.º 4
0
 public ChangeTokenLiteralString(ITokenFactory factoryTokens, IFactoryNames factoryNames)
 {
     this.factoryTokens = factoryTokens;
     this.factoryNames  = factoryNames;
 }
Exemplo n.º 5
0
 public Dictionary <string, string> GetMapNames(IEnumerable <string> list, IFactoryNames factoryNames)
 {
     return(list.ToDictionary(key => key, value => factoryNames.GetShortName(value)));
 }
Exemplo n.º 6
0
 public HtmlEditor(IFactoryNames factoryNames, IFactoryEditor factoryEditor)
 {
     this.factoryNames  = factoryNames;
     this.factoryEditor = factoryEditor;
 }
 public JsVisitorChangeLiteralString(IFactoryNames factoryNames, ITokenFactory factory)
 {
     editString = new ChangeTokenLiteralString(factory, factoryNames);
 }
Exemplo n.º 8
0
 public CssEditNameClassSelector(ITokenFactory factoryTokens, IFactoryNames factoryNames)
 {
     this.factoryTokens = factoryTokens;
     this.factoryNames  = factoryNames;
 }
Exemplo n.º 9
0
 public HtmlVisitorEditorScriptTag(IFactoryNames factoryNames, ITokenFactory factory, IFactoryEditor factoryEditor)
 {
     editScript   = new ChangeTokenScript(factory, factoryEditor);
     this.factory = factory;
 }
Exemplo n.º 10
0
 public EditLiteralString(IFactoryNames factoryNames)
 {
     this.factoryNames = factoryNames;
 }
Exemplo n.º 11
0
 public CssEditor(IFactoryNames factoryNames)
 {
     this.factoryNames = factoryNames;
 }
 public HtmlVisitorChangeAtributeValue(IFactoryNames factoryNames, ITokenFactory factory)
 {
     editString   = new ChangeTokenAtributeValue(factory, factoryNames);
     this.factory = factory;
 }